Adjusting Print Head Height to Match Media Thickness
This section explains how to adjust the print head height to match the media thickness.
The height of the print head is set with
. Changing this height may affect the printing quality. Normally do not change this setting.However when printing on thick media and when swelling occurred due to drying after printing, the distance between the print heads and the print surface will be smaller than the intended value. Depending on the circumstances, the print head may contact the media. In order to avoid this, change the height of the print head. If the print head height on the printer and the setting are different, a message may be displayed on the printer. In this situation, make the settings the same.
Depending on the model you are using, this setting may be disabled.
